Martin Anyangwe Obituary, Death;- The identity of a driver who lost his life in a crash on September 1 was disclosed on Monday by the Prince George’s County Police Department. Martin Anyangwe, aged 73, from Beltsville, was the individual who perished in the incident.

The single-vehicle accident occurred shortly before 10 p.m. at the intersection of Powder Mill Road and Cherry Hill Road. Authorities reported that Anyangwe succumbed to his injuries at the scene.

According to the initial investigation, the victim was traveling south on Powder Mill Road when, for reasons that are still being examined, the vehicle veered off the road and collided with a utility pole.

Individuals possessing information regarding this incident are encouraged to reach out to the Collision Analysis and Reconstruction Unit at 301-731-4422.
